Gatekeep is Brambleworth's internal API gateway. Rate limits are enforced per service token: 500 req/min default, burst 100. On-call: if a service trips limits repeatedly, check the quota map in gatekeep-config before raising anything. Overrides require the limiter admin token, which the gateway reads from its env file at boot. Add the following line to /etc/gatekeep/.env before restarting.

vault entry, yahif-yajep: COURIER_KEY29=b802bdf8034096b65a51c6ba5abe2

## Deployment

Squill lints all SQL files at deploy time. Non-compliant files block the pipeline; no overrides in prod. Rules: uppercase keywords, explicit column lists (no SELECT *), required table aliases, and a statement-length cap. Reviewers: reject PRs that disable rules inline — exceptions go through the lint-policy file only. Run the linter locally before pushing; it's the same binary the pipeline uses. The linter resolves its active ruleset from the configuration below.

config for bawig-fadup:
[zorix]
host = zorix.lumicworks.corp
user = zorix_svc
database = zorix_prod

## Idempotency Keys for Payment Retries (Lumopay)

Every retry of a charge request must reuse the original idempotency key; generating a new key on retry can produce duplicate charges. Keys are scoped per merchant and expire after 48 hours. Reviewers should verify keys are derived server-side, never from client input. The full key-generation specification and threat model are maintained on the internal page.

dashboard of kaguf-tawip = https://vault.merlaqsys.test/issue